Insightful does employee monitoring properly. It is mature, focused, and if watching activity is genuinely the only thing you need, it will do that job well. The question worth asking before you buy it is whether monitoring alone is what your business actually has a problem with.

The difference is what your team gets in return

A monitoring tool gives an employer visibility and gives an employee nothing. That asymmetry is why monitoring rollouts go badly: staff experience a product installed on them rather than for them, and the resentment outlasts the insight. WorkAndGo is the chat app your team uses all day, with their roster, their leave balance, their timesheet and their payslip in it. Monitoring is one layer inside something they already open, which is a materially easier conversation to have with a workforce.

Where your data physically sits, and why it is not a detail

Insightful’s own privacy policy states: “Insightful Operates from the United States”, that information “may be transferred, processed and/or accessed by us in the United States”, and that if your information is there “it may be accessed by government authorities in accordance with U.S. law”. The words Australia and Sydney do not appear anywhere on their privacy or security pages. That is not a criticism of the company — it is a US product and says so plainly. It is a question for an Australian employer, because screenshots of your staff’s screens are among the most sensitive records you will ever hold, and you will be asked where they are kept. WorkAndGo keeps them in Sydney.

Award interpretation is the gap nobody in monitoring fills

Monitoring tells you someone worked. It does not tell you what you owe them. If you run shifts in retail or hospitality, the expensive question is not whether a shift happened but whether Saturday loading, evening penalties and overtime thresholds were applied correctly. WorkAndGo interprets the shift against the award and shows the working line by line, so you can see how a figure was reached and check it against the current Fair Work rates rather than guessing. It is a calculator and a cross-check, not a replacement for the Fair Work Commission as the source of truth for what you pay.

Questions people ask

Is employee monitoring legal in Australia?

It is lawful in Australia when it is disclosed. WorkAndGo is built for that: monitoring is off by default, switched on per person rather than per workforce, and an employee sees a disclosure naming what is captured before anything is. Personal devices only capture between clock-in and clock-out. We are not lawyers and this is not legal advice — surveillance law differs by state and your obligations are yours — but nothing in the product requires you to monitor anyone covertly, and it will not let you.

Where is WorkAndGo data stored?

Everything your organisation stores stays in Sydney (australia-southeast1): messages, files, HR records, timesheets and screenshots, with backups in the same region. The AI assistant also runs in Sydney rather than sending your team’s conversations offshore for processing. Some service providers we use to deliver the product — email and SMS delivery, for example — operate overseas, which is set out in our privacy policy.

Where does Insightful store data?

According to Insightful’s own privacy policy, it operates from the United States and information may be transferred to, processed in and accessed from there. We are quoting their published policy rather than characterising it, and you should read it yourself before deciding — it is the kind of thing that changes.

How long are screenshots kept?

You choose, per organisation, and the setting is enforced nightly rather than described. Screenshots default to 90 days and you set the period to whatever your obligations require. When a screenshot expires the image is destroyed while the record that a capture happened survives — so your audit trail stays intact and you can demonstrate the retention policy actually ran.

Can employees see what is being captured about them?

Yes. Every monitored person acknowledges a disclosure naming what is collected before collection starts, and can see their own productivity view. Contractors, managers and owners are never monitored regardless of any setting — that ceiling is enforced in the product, not left to an administrator to remember.

What does WorkAndGo cost compared with Insightful?

Personal is free for up to 25 people and includes chat, tasks, calendar, clock-in/out and leave. Starter is $9 per person per month and adds rostering, Fair Work award interpretation and payroll export. Professional is $16 and adds monitoring, productivity analytics and compliance. Prices exclude GST and are charged per person from the first person — there is no minimum and no seat block to buy up front.
